BILL PUPP

1949 - 2007

William John Pupp, beloved husband of Terry Pupp of Lethbridge, passed away at the St. Michael’s Health Centre, Palliative Care, on Wednesday, September 12, 2007 at the age of 58 years.
Bill was born and raised in Taber where he received his schooling. He furthered his education at SAIT in Calgary in Auto Body. Bill’s passion was ‘auto painting’ and he was known to all as “Bill Pupp the painter”. Vehicles were his pride and joy. His painting skills began to flourish as he worked at various Body Shops. He did artistry paint jobs on vehicles for the local car shows.
In the later part of 1975 he incorporated a firm he named Cupid Manufacturing, which was Canada’s only manufacturer of compound and recurve bows. Painting on the handles pursued his artistry of many flavors - one such bow was done for William Shatner of Star Trek.
Pupp’s Classic Auto was his business for many years where he focused on antique cars. It was here his talents were unlimited. He restored many vehicles for friends, family and customers. He went on to work at Nissan Body Shop and later Davis Pontiac in Lethbridge. For the past two years Bill taught an Auto Body Paint course at the Lethbridge College. He did van conversions for a few years and crafted many pieces of furniture/waterbeds.  You name it - Bill paints it.
